Position Overview:
We are looking for hardworking and reliable field technicians with a background in hazmat spills and environmental remediation. The ideal candidate will have strong communication skills, confidence in the industry, and a desire for career growth. This is an entry-level position with opportunities for training, development, and advancement within the company.
Key Responsibilities:
🛠 Respond to hazardous materials spills and assist with environmental cleanup and remediation efforts.
🌍 Work in the field as part of a specialized response team to mitigate environmental damage.
📢 Communicate effectively with clients, team members, and supervisors on project progress.
⚠️ Follow all safety protocols and guidelines to ensure compliance and workplace safety.
🔧 Assist in maintaining and preparing equipment and materials for field projects.
Qualifications & Requirements:
✔ Prior experience in hazmat spill response and environmental remediation preferred.
✔ Strong communication and customer service skills to engage with clients and team members.
✔ Confidence in the environmental industry with a willingness to learn.
✔ Ability to work in physically demanding conditions, including outdoor environments.
✔ Commitment to safety procedures and regulations.
